My fav one, the DB 15 :
This watch has the specific moonphases from DB and a power reserve of 5 days.
Look at the shape of the hands in order to run over the moon :
The caliber is beautiful.
The balance wheel is made of titanium and platinum.

The DB 20 Qi : You will notice the horizontal power reserve indicator.
With the DB 22 :
The DB 22 has a beautiful titanium dial, titanium&steel hands :
The rotor is made of titanium&platinum. Look at the triple shock protection system in the balance bridge :

The DBS is a very interesting watch. It's maybe the most innovative watch from DB.
First of all, the dial is totally open :
But the main feature of the watch is the ability to control the speed (and so the efficiency) of the winding system.
The technology used is different from the system used by Urwerk in the 202 (with the turbines). But it's impressive too.
You can control the speed through the crown. The efficiency is displayed at the back of the watch :
